For the sweet potato fries I just cut some sweet potatos into fries and tossed them in an oil, cumin (salt, pepper) and tarragon mixture. I cooked them at 450 degrees for 15 minutes and then turned them over for another 15 minutes or until crispy. boy I do love those sweet little guys.
